What are Product Tags?

Every product in Cibigi Showcase can be assigned one or more Product Tags. Product tags help organize your products, improve navigation, and provide a flexible way to associate products that share similar characteristics.

Unlike Product Categories, tags do not have a hierarchy. This means there are no parent or child tags (or “subtags”). Instead, tags are designed to identify common characteristics that may exist across multiple categories.

Example

Imagine you’re managing a fashion store in Cibigi Showcase.

You might organize your products into categories such as:

  • Men’s Clothing
  • Women’s Clothing
  • Children’s Clothing

Within those categories, you may also have subcategories such as:

  • Shirts
  • Pants
  • Jackets

To provide additional details about each product, you can use tags such as:

  • Cotton
  • Polyester
  • Eco-Friendly
  • Water-Resistant

This tagging strategy allows customers who are specifically looking for Cotton products, for example, to quickly view every cotton item across your entire Cibigi Showcase catalog, regardless of its category.

Using Product Tags improves the shopping experience by helping customers discover products that match their interests without having to browse through your entire catalog.

How to Add or Edit Product Tags

Product Tags can be managed in several places within Cibigi Showcase.

Method 1: Products > Tags

From the Products > Tags screen, you can create new tags and manage existing ones.

  1. Name – Enter the name of the Product Tag.
  2. Slug (Optional) – A URL-friendly version of the tag name. If left blank, one will be automatically generated.
  3. Description (Optional) – Some themes display this description, most commonly beneath the tag name on the tag’s landing page.

Method 2: Edit Product Screen

You can also add or create Product Tags while editing an individual product using the Product Tags section.

  1. Type the name of an existing tag.
    • Matching tags will appear for you to select.
    • After selecting the appropriate tags, choose Add to assign them to the product.
  2. To create a new tag, enter the new tag name and select the Add button.
  3. Alternatively, select Choose from the most used tags at the bottom of the Product Tags section.
    • This automatically displays the tags you use most frequently across your products.

Method 3: Bulk Edit Products

You can also add Product Tags to multiple products at once using the Bulk Edit feature from Products > All Products.

  • From the All Products screen, select the checkbox beside each product you want to update.
  • Open the Bulk Edit tool.
  • Locate the Product Tags field.
    • Type the name of an existing tag and select it.
    • Or enter a new tag name to create a new Product Tag.

Viewing Product Tags

After assigning Product Tags to your products, you can verify how they appear in Cibigi Showcase by:

  • Selecting the Product Tag from a product page to view all products using that tag.
  • Selecting View from the Products > Tags page to open the Product Tag landing page.
